Given the increasing complexity of software deployments and the diversity of development environments, what are the key considerations for selecting a CI/CD toolchain that ensures both scalability and adaptability across various development stacks and infrastructure setups? Are there emerging trends in CI/CD tooling that address these challenges, particularly in large-scale enterprise environments?

4.3k viewscircle icon2 Comments
Sort by:
IT Analyst in Media2 years ago

Advanced pipeline orchestration tools are emerging to manage complex workflows involving multiple stages, environments, and dependencies.

Software Engineer in Software2 years ago

Open-source vs. vendor-locked: Opt for flexible open-source options or platform-agnostic vendors for adaptability.
Integration capabilities: Choose tools with strong integrations with various stacks and cloud providers.
Configurability and extensibility: Look for tools that can be customized to your specific needs and workflows.
Containerization support: Prioritize tools that leverage containers for scalability and portability.
Automation & self-service: Focus on tools enabling automated pipelines and developer self-service.

Remember: No one-size-fits-all solution exists. Prioritize your specific needs and evaluate tools based on these key considerations and trends.

Content you might like

Waterfall13%

Prototype19%

Rapid Application Development7%

Agile Scrum45%

Agile Kanban8%

Dynamic System Development1%

Lean Software Development2%

Other .. please add it down2%

View Results

Over 50% in 1 year

Over 50% in 3 years100%

Over 50% in 5 years

Over 50% in 10 years

Not sure/difficult to state

View Results